项目摘要

Software is an enabling technology so good that there is now almost no new device/technology on the market that does not depend on software in some way. As software and devices become increasingly complex and safety features, relying more and more on software, get further intertwined with functional features, the chance of creating serious disasters also dramatically increases. This is especially true in the medical domain where there is tremendous pressure to get new devices onto the market in the hope of saving lives and/or improving quality of life, but where those same devices can cause immense harm if they are not safe for use. Regulatory regimes for software usually rely on checking that an approved development process was used, and then infer from that the software will not contribute to a device failure. Predictably this has not worked well. Safety Cases have been mandatory in several regulatory domains in the UK for many years. Safety cases force manufacturers to provide evidence related to the manufactured product. We are starting to see assurance/safety cases assuming a more prominent role in regulatory regimes in North America. This is especially true in the approach taken by the US FDA in the way they regulate medical devices. Assurance cases are predicated on assumptions that promote satisfactory confidence in the efficacy and safety of the device. These assumptions relate to fundamental issues that have not yet been addressed. I intend to reverse engineer standards to discover the implicit assurance cases embodied therein. I also plan to compare approaches to argumentation from philosophy and formal methods to help create a means by which supporting arguments can be evaluated. My research focuses on determining: i) how to construct and evaluate claims and sub-claims which contribute to the overall dependability and safety of the system; ii) how to evaluate the soundness of arguments in the context of satisfying claims; iii) how to combine evidence of different types to contribute to the confidence that a claim is satisfied; and iv) how to organize the assurance case using a prescribed structure, which will facilitate certifiers being able to build experience in evaluating assurance cases.
